      <title>Outbound rule for delete/move</title>
      <link>https://connect.hyland.com/t5/alfresco-archive/outbound-rule-for-delete-move/m-p/135134#M94837</link>
      <description>Hi All,I want to define a rule that on delete content do javascript X and on move content do javascript Y.The only option I have is outbound rule that apply for delete and move.Is there a way to identify the action (delete or move) from the javascript of outbound rule?Thx in advance,&amp;nbsp; Itay</description>

      <description>&lt;HTML&gt;&lt;HEAD&gt;&lt;/HEAD&gt;&lt;BODY&gt;&lt;SPAN&gt;you cannot defile the rule just for move and not for delete…. but what you can do in the executed javascript is check if the node still exists. There is no explicit method for that but if you use the &l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;STRONG&gt;toString()&lt;/STRONG&gt;&lt;SPAN&gt; method and the node doesn't exist it will return something like:&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BLOCKQUOTE class="jive-quote"&gt;Node no longer exists: workspace://SpacesStore/….&lt;/BLOCKQUOTE&gt;&lt;/BODY&gt;&lt;/HTML&gt;</description>
